Construction Superintendent
We are seeking an experienced and highly motivated Construction Superintendent to oversee and manage the daily operations of our multi-family development projects. The Superintendent will be responsible for ensuring that the project is completed on time, within budget, and to the highest quality standards. The role requires a strong leader who can effectively manage a team, coordinate subcontractors, maintain safety standards, and resolve issues on-site.
This is a hands-on position that requires someone who thrives in a fast-paced, dynamic environment and can manage multiple aspects of the construction process.
Key
Duties and Responsibilities:
- Site Management:
Oversee daily operations on the jobsite, ensuring that construction activities run smoothly, safely, and according to schedule. - Project Scheduling:
Collaborate with the project manager and general contractor to develop and maintain an accurate construction schedule. Ensure that all milestones are met, and resolve any delays or issues promptly. - Team Leadership:
Supervise and manage on-site workers, including subcontractors, laborers, and other construction personnel. Ensure a high level of performance, quality, and safety on the jobsite. - Quality Control:
Inspect work completed by subcontractors and tradespeople to ensure compliance with design specifications, quality standards, and safety regulations. Address any quality issues in real-time. - Safety Management:
Enforce safety protocols and ensure compliance with OSHA regulations. Conduct regular site safety meetings, inspections, and risk assessments to maintain a safe working environment. - Subcontractor Coordination:
Schedule and manage subcontractors, ensuring that they adhere to the project schedule, quality standards, and safety requirements. - Materials and Equipment:
Oversee the delivery and proper storage of materials and equipment on-site. Ensure that all necessary materials are available when needed to avoid delays. - Documentation:
Maintain accurate records, including daily logs, progress reports, and change orders. Report any issues, delays, or incidents to the project manager. - Problem-Solving:
Quickly identify problems on the jobsite, from construction delays to equipment malfunctions, and take proactive measures to resolve them. - Client and Stakeholder Communication:
Maintain effective communication with clients, architects, engineers, and other project stakeholders to ensure that the project meets expectations and is completed to specification.
